RetroArch

RetroArch

Gaming Software

RetroArch is an open-source, cross-platform frontend for emulators, game engines, video games, media players and other applications. It's designed to be fast, lightweight, customizable and extensible.

Vimwiki

Vimwiki

Development

Vimwiki is a personal wiki for Vim text editor. It allows users to organize notes, to-do lists, ideas, and other content in plain text files inside Vim. Vimwiki offers wiki-style linking between pages and powerful text formatting.
